As a Senior Customer Service Representative / Contracts Administrator, you will be at the forefront of managing intricate customer relationships and handling complex orders. This role is perfect for those who thrive in solving challenging issues and have experience working with the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) or similar departments.

As a Contracts Administrator, You'll Be Responsible for: Complex Order Management: Efficiently processing and overseeing complex customer orders, ensuring adherence to trade regulations and customer specifications. Effective Communication: Responding to customer RFQs/RFPs with precision, managing follow- ups, and ensuring accurate documentation. Strategic Pricing and Quoting: Crafting pricing proposals for off-contract opportunities, and participating in the quoting process in collaboration with Business Unit Managers and finance teams. Customer Portal Management: Overseeing customer portals for order retrieval, acceptance/rejection, quoting, and updates. Issue Resolution: Tackling customer complaints and inquiries, coordinating across departments to solve issues with shipments and orders.

The successful Senior Contracts Administrator will have the below: Bachelors Degree is preferred but not essential 3+ years of experience in contracts administration Knowledge of working within defense/governmental agencies such as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Familiarity with US Government FAR/DFAR regulations, SAM/DIBB databases, and USG negotiation. Demonstrable skills to include; excel functions like VLOOKUPs and PivotTables. Skilled at aligning customer requests with contractual stipulations and business conditions.
